Subject: Crate of survey instruments — Tuesday run

Hi dispatch team,

Quick one from the office manager's desk. The crate of survey instruments for the Pellworth ridge project is packed and waiting in bay C — it's the big green one with the Ardex Instruments stencil. It's heavier than it looks, so please use the trolley, and make sure the calibration certificates stay taped inside the lid. Kestrel Freight is collecting Tuesday at 10:00. The confidential courier hand-over instruction follows immediately below.

courier memo of tawep-tajep: the quenius ulaiel courier leaves the fenir ledger at gate 9128 under passcode 527513

The MergeWell customer-record deduplication job on staging was reading the production candidate queue because the env file was copied verbatim during the Harlow migration. Future maintainers: the dedupe service needs its own scoped credentials per environment, never shared. We rotated the staging credential and rebuilt the env file from the template. Queue names, batch size, and region are already corrected below. The final entry to restore is the line that authenticates the dedupe worker against the match-scoring service, which goes here:

vault entry, bagep-yahip: VAULT_KEY8=d2a227e5

Leadership Review Briefing — Reseller Programme

For the incoming director: the Ashgrove reseller programme covers 34 partners across three territories. Top five resellers drive 70% of channel revenue. Margin tiers were compressed last quarter; two partners have threatened exit. Renewal cycle starts next month. Proposed restructuring is detailed in the confidential note below.

board note of fahif-yahog: Gross margin on Wenath came in at 10 percent against a plan of 5 percent. Only 3 of the 100 pilot accounts renewed Wenath, so a churn review is set for July 15.

Passing this to you before review. The Brindlekit shared component library moved to strict semver last sprint; consumers now pin minor versions via the resolver manifest instead of floating on latest. The publish pipeline tags releases automatically, but the registry mirror in the Oslenn cluster lags by about an hour, so don't be alarmed if a fresh tag isn't resolvable immediately. Watch for the peer-dependency range on the theming package — that's where past breakage came from. Current resolver settings follow.

service settings:
PRAIX_LOG_LEVEL=error
PRAIX_METRICS_HOST=metrics.praix.qorvelcorp.corp
PRAIX_POOL_SIZE=16